Selection Preview

When you are using fillet radius and you want to see where the radius will be make sure SELECTIONPREVIEW is on.

Objects are highlighted when the pickbox cursor rolls over them. The highlighting indicates that the object would be selected if you clicked it. The setting is stored as a bitcode using the sum of the following values:

0=OFF , 1=On when no commands are active, 2=On when a command prompts for object selection

Importing C3D Styles into multiple drawings

Have you ever had to update multiple drawings with updated C3D styles?

Here is how you do it.

Turn "filedia" OFF

Put in your directory Path and Filename you want to be updated.

Turn "cmddia" OFF

"importstylesandsettings" is the command to import the styles

Put the DWG or DWT file you want to import with new styles here

"Y" overwrites the current styles in DWG

Tuesday TIP - Label Styles

Label Styles are great for keeping your design set clean and standardized. Make sure you sit down before the project and think of all the standard callouts you may have in the set. Don't worry, if you need one later just add it to your DWT file and import it into the sheets you need it in.

I had to create special style for the grade callout so the negative was in parentheses.(with help from RK McSwain!)

Viewports Vertical

Quick tip for the newb's....
If you are running C3D and have 2 monitors, split your view with viewport vertically.
This will allow you to have your plan view on one side and maybe your profile or cross sections on the other.
make sure to turn ucsfollow off so the view does not change every time you change active views.
